I have a 1998 Honda Accord Coupe V-6 Auto. It ran like a raped ape! Then started throwing codes like p300, p303, p304, p306, p1399, p1457 and run rough... I was planning on a tune up anyway, a major one since it just hit 99k, so I went to work! I replaced the EGR, Cap, Rotor, Coil, Plugs, Wires, Module but to no avail! I do alright when it comes to automotive work and realized that these were also symptoms of a bad coolant temp sensor/switch! It's not a big deal to me because like I said, I was planning on a major tune up anyway! So tomorrow I'll change that and my thermostat and O2 sensors. Then it will be good for at least another 100k (not overlooking timing belt replacement, oil, tranny fluid changes) BTW, if you own a automatic Honda, why not change your tranny fluid when you change your oil? 3 1/2 quarts of HONDA AT FLUID, Dextron will only cost you a new tranny! Did you ever figure it out? My '03 Accord just did the same thing.....all the bulbs are good, just the left side is dead.
#26 of 30
Re: turn signal not working [shawn29] by ldamop
Oct 20, 2008 (4:58 pm)
Reply

Replying to: shawn29 (Oct 20, 2008 1:05 pm)

Yes, but I had to take it to the Honda dealer to find out. It was a faulty fuse box and relay assembly. The mechanic performed a test on the system with HDS (whatever that is) to determine it was not working. Since they are all one unit the entire thing had to be replaced. My Honda dealer charged me $357.67. (The actual parts were $196.60 and labor was $158.00. There was a miscellaneous charge of $15 and tax was $22.62. They gave me some sort of discount which amounted to $34.55).
